The apartment Melnicka Mala Strana is located in the heart of the Lesser Town (called Mala Strana) which is the oldest district of Prague, founded in the Middle age, with dominant renaissance and baroque styles, on a quiet street , in walking distance from the famous Charles bridge, Prague castle, National theatre and other sights. Near the river bank with its pleasant Kampa park. This is the romantic and beautiful district of Prague! There are many good restaurants, taverns, jazz-bar and cafes in the vicinity.
You can discover and enjoy the city centre by walking directly from this location and access to all tourist sites. Shopping center with Tesco about 7 min walk. Historical building from Apartment Melnicka Mala Strana was built in the second half of 19th century. In the whole Apartment Melnicka Mala Strana is smoking prohibited.
You don’t need to live like a tourist while you visit Prague; you can live in a real apartment in the centre of town. We supply fresh linens and towels. Easily can accommodate 5 people. There are 1 double bed, one pull out couch for 2 people as well and one sleeper chair bed for 1, wardrobe, TV, table with chairs. Fully equipped kitchen, with cooker, fridge, kettle, plates, cutlery, glasses, microwave.
